I am flying this coming Thursday night, actually Friday morning, at 12:40AM on Flt. 1470 to DFW from SEA. I called in last night at 12:40AM to upgrade to only find the flight on a waitlist. Spoke to the the SMS rep and he told me my chances of upgrading were slim to none that there were quiet a few GM's ahead of me. Now I did call at 12:40 and chances are no one trying to get (v) could have been ahead of me. I have never not been upgraded on this flight and he did inform me that the waitlist was quiet long, most likely filled with NAMU's. Just wondering what the rest of you had for input on this flight and the upgradebility?? Apparently it is oversold as well.

Looks from my favorite Japanese site like there is plenty of availability up front, but likely well oversold in back. I would imagine they'll clear a lot of the waitlist to free up seats in Y. My gut tells me that if you don't get an upgrade, you are likely to have a bump opportunity, but the former is more likely.
